Apple announces fellowship with National Association of Black Journalists

The fellowship is already open to applicants.

What you need to know


Apple News has announced a fellowship in partnership with the National Association of Black Journalists.
The fellowship is now open to applicants.


In a post to Twitter, Apple has announced that it is launching an editorial fellowship for its Apple News service in partnership with the National Association of Black Journalists. The fellowship, as Apple explains, will "give early-career journalists the opportunity to work at the forefront of news and technology."
